Michael J. "Mick" Bretthauer, 69, of Fort Dodge, died Monday, February 26, 2018, at the Paula J. Baber Hospice Home.

A service honoring Mick's life will be 10:00 a.m. Saturday, March 3, at Epworth United Methodist Church. Interment will be in North Lawn Cemetery. Military honors will be presented by V.F.W. Post No. 1856 and the United States Air Force Honor Guard. Visitation is 9:00 to 10:00 a.m. Saturday at the church. Memorials may be directed to the discretion of the family.

Mick is survived by his sister Mary Burris, Moorland; brothers, Rick Bretthauer, North Liberty; Chuck Bretthauer, Fort Dodge; and Terry (Kay) Bretthauer, Urbandale; and several n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ews. He was preceded in death by his parents, Glen and Betty, his brother Phil Bretthauer, his niece Janelle Cravens, his brother-in-law Bob Burris and his nephew Derek Burris.

Michael J. "Mick" Bretthauer, the son of Glen and Betty (Shugart) Bretthauer, was born April 24, 1948, in Fort Dodge. He graduated from Fort Dodge Senior High in 1966 and Iowa Central in 1968. He attended the University of Northern Iowa, prior to his entry in the United States Air Force, for which he served from 1971 to 1975, including a tour of Vietnam from 1972 to 1973. Following his discharge, Mick returned to Fort Dodge and was employed by the United States Postal Service for 40 years, before his retirement in 2011.

Mick was an avid fan of Iowa State athletic teams. He enjoyed Nascar, watching TV oldies, bike riding and family gatherings.
